GREEN BAY, Wis. (SPECTRUM NEWS) — The unemployment numbers are astounding.

More than 200,000 people in Wisconsin have applied for unemployment in the last two weeks as both society and the economy have ground to a halt due to the coronavirus pandemic.

But some businesses are still hiring.

To help both employers and prospective employees, the Greater Green Bay Chamber is offering a new website listing open jobs in the region. The project is in conjunction with the NEW Manufacturing Alliance.

Listings run from entry level production work to machinists and welders.

“We want people to understand there are still many companies hiring and there are companies hiring for regular jobs they already had posted and there are companies ramping up and hiring  temporary, interim, folks as well,” said Kelly Armstrong, Vice President of economic development with the chamber.

The pandemic has hit business sectors like hospitality, restaurants and retail especially hard hard.

For those out of work, Armstrong said access to job listings can be a bright spot in challenging times.

“If you’re in the job market already, there is hope,” she said.
